Effects Of AM Fungi On Soil Carbon And Nitrogen Under Warming And Nitrogen Deposition In Songnen Meadow Steppe

Arbuscular mycorrhiza fungi?AM fungi?is one of the most important soil microbes in the terrestrial ecosystems,which can form mycorrhizal association with more 80% terrestrial plant.AM fungi can improve plant growth by increasing nutrients and water uptake.The host plant supply the necessary carbohydrate to keep the growth of AM fungi.AM fungi can significantly enhance soil carbon?C?sequestration,increase the net primary productivity of ecosystems.Moreover,AM fungi can increase nitrogen?N?absorption and utilization,and alter N distribution among different plant species.However,the influence of AM fungi on soil C and N cyclings under global change is still not well understood.In the present study,we studied the effects of AM fungi on soil C and N under warming and N deposition in Songnen meadow.The research results are as follows:?1?AM fungi significantly increased the total soil C content across the four treatments.In the warming plus N addition treatment,AM fungi increased the total soil C content.?2?AM fungi significantly increased the soil N content?P< 0.05?under N addition.AM fungi also significantly altered the content of nitrate N and ammonium N.In warming,N addition,warming plus N addition treatments,AM fungi significantly reduced the content of soil nitrate N and ammonium N.?3?With the increase of temperature precipitation during growing season,soil respiration reached the maximum value.However,the single environmental factors and the role of AM fungi was not significant effect on soil respiration.There were significant interactive effects of N addition × AM fungi,warming × N addition × AM fungi on the soil respiration.?4?AM fungi significantly reduced the emission of soil N2 O.AM fungi highly reduced the emission of N2 O under the warming and N addition.AM fungi significantly reduced the CH4 emission under N addition.In contrast,AM fungi significantly increased the release of CH4 t under warming plus N addition.In summary,AM fungi had no significant impact on the soil C and N content and soil respiration in the short-term experiments under warming and N addition.AM fungi significantly altered the content of soil organic N and the emission of greenhouse under global change.AM fungi can alleviate emissions of greenhouse gases and reduce the negative effects of warming on grassland ecosystem.
